Skip to content

Mirror GitLab Repo

Mirror GitLab Repo #91

Workflow file for this run

name: Mirror GitLab Repo
on:
schedule:
- cron: '0 0 * * *'
workflow_dispatch:
jobs:
mirror:
runs-on: ubuntu-latest
steps:
- name: Install SSH key
uses: webfactory/ssh-agent@v0.9.0
with:
ssh-private-key: ${{ secrets.PRIV_KEY }}
- name: Mirror repository
run: |
git clone --mirror https://git.pertforge.ismb.it/moderate/diva.git
cd diva.git
git push --mirror git@github.com:MODERATE-Project/moderate-diva.git